Home and Away actress Jessica Falkholt is in a coma in hospital following a crash on St Stephen's Day in New South Wales, Australia that killed her parents and 21-year-old sister Annabelle.

Providing an update on Jessica's condition, a relative told The Daily Mail Australia: "We're not going to know much about Jessica's real condition for a while.

The neurosurgeon who has been treating her has said that the operation on her brain has gone well but it is just a waiting game. 

The relative said: "She could be in a coma for weeks or even months, she still has all the swelling on her brain. They haven't even been able to test her brain yet. They'll probably have to wait a week or two now and see how she responds to the surgery."

According to Australian television network ABC, police claim that the crash was caused by one car being on the wrong side of the road.

Jessica was Hope Morrison on Home and Away in 2016, in the 16 episodes she was in, she was arrested for stealing credit card details and kidnapped by Spike Lowe.
